Governors Camp in the Masai Mara is a luxury tented camp located in the heart of the famous Masai Mara Reserve in Kenya. Surrounded by rolling savannah grasslands and breathtaking views of the Mara River, Governors Camp offers an authentic and unforgettable African safari experience.
Governors' Camp is located in the prime wildlife viewing area of the Masai Mara Reserve, situated on the banks of the Mara River surrounded by a lush riverine forest, teeming with birdlife, hippos, and crocodiles. This camp is ideal for couples, families, and friends seeking to experience the best of what the Masai Mara has to offer on a safari.
In November 2022, Governors' Camp reduced to only 25 tents increasing its privacy and making the camp more exclusive.
The entire camp is designed with comfort in mind and housed in luxurious canvas tents. Some tents are situated along the riverbank and offer breathtaking views of the Mara River, while others have stunning views of the plains. The spacious tents are filled with natural light and have a classic safari-style design, complete with en-suite bathrooms and private verandahs. The bar tent boasts a deck with views of the Mara River, while the dining tent offers a stunning panorama of the plains.
The camp offers a range of activities to ensure guests have a truly memorable experience. Early morning and late afternoon game drives are conducted in open-topped vehicles, providing exceptional views of the wildlife and scenery. The Masai Mara is known for its abundant wildlife, including the big five (lion, elephant, buffalo, leopard and rhino), as well as a diverse range of other species such as cheetahs, zebras, wildebeest and more.
For those seeking a more immersive experience, the camp offers walking safaris led by experienced guides. These guided walks offer a unique perspective on the wildlife, landscapes and culture of the Mara.
In addition to the wildlife experiences, Governors Camp also offers a range of cultural activities. Guests can visit nearby Masai villages and learn about the customs and traditions of the local community. The camp also employs members of the Masai community, offering guests an opportunity to learn about the people who call the Mara home.

Governors Camp prides itself on its commitment to sustainability and the environment. Governors’ Camp has been awarded a Silver Eco Rating from Eco – Tourism Kenya due to our sustainable tourism practices in place in camp and supporting local communities.
